TLV379IDR Description
The TLV379IDR is a general-purpose operational amplifier (op-amp) designed for a wide range of applications requiring low power consumption and high performance. Manufactured by Texas Instruments, this op-amp is housed in a surface-mount 8SOIC package, making it suitable for compact and space-constrained designs. The TLV379IDR operates within a supply voltage range of 1.8 V to 5.5 V, providing flexibility for various power supply configurations. With a supply current of just 4µA, it is ideal for battery-powered and low-power systems. The op-amp features a gain bandwidth product of 90 kHz and a slew rate of 0.03V/µs, ensuring stable and precise signal amplification. The low input bias current of 5 pA and an input offset voltage of 800 µV contribute to its high accuracy and reliability. The TLV379IDR is REACH unaffected and RoHS3 compliant, adhering to stringent environmental regulations. It is available in a tape and reel (TR) package, facilitating efficient manufacturing processes.
